NEW IBERIA, La. â A New Iberia man has been arrested after fleeing from U.S. Marshals serving a warrant that led to a vehicle pursuit through St. Martinville.
According to the New Iberia Police Department, U.S. Marshals were serving an arrest warrant Wednesday on Lee Street for Donvontae Ozenne, who was wanted for a previous charge of Attempted 2nd Degree Murder.
Police say when the marshals attempted to serve the warrant, Ozenne fled in a vehicle through New Iberia, which then led them through St. Martinville.
